Lesson 1: Overview of Oracle Database Migration
Introduction to Database Migration
Importance of Database Migration
Key Concepts and Terminologies
Types of Database Migration
Migration Tools and Technologies
Planning and Preparation
Risk Assessment and Mitigation
Case Studies and Examples
Best Practices
Common Challenges and Solutions
Lesson 2: Understanding Oracle Database Architecture
Oracle Database Overview
Database Architecture Components
Memory Structures
Process Structures
Storage Structures
Schema Objects
Data Dictionary
Oracle Instance vs. Database
Oracle Database Versions and Features
Database Configuration and Tuning
Lesson 3: Migration Strategies and Approaches
Overview of Migration Strategies
Lift-and-Shift Migration
Replatforming
Refactoring
Hybrid Migration Approaches
Choosing the Right Strategy
Migration Planning and Execution
Tools and Technologies for Migration
Case Studies
Best Practices and Lessons Learned
Lesson 4: Pre-Migration Assessment and Planning
Importance of Pre-Migration Assessment
Assessing Source and Target Environments
Identifying Migration Scope and Objectives
Data Profiling and Analysis
Dependency Mapping
Risk Assessment and Mitigation Planning
Resource Planning
Timeline and Milestones
Stakeholder Communication
Documentation and Reporting
Module 2: Oracle Database Migration Tools and Technologies
Lesson 5: Introduction to Oracle Migration Tools
Overview of Oracle Migration Tools
Oracle Data Pump
Oracle GoldenGate
Oracle SQL Developer
Oracle Migration Workbench
Oracle Database Upgrade Assistant
Third-Party Migration Tools
Tool Selection Criteria
Installation and Configuration
Best Practices for Tool Usage
Lesson 6: Oracle Data Pump
Introduction to Oracle Data Pump
Data Pump Architecture
Export and Import Utilities
Data Pump Parameters and Options
Performing Data Pump Operations
Monitoring and Managing Data Pump Jobs
Troubleshooting Data Pump Issues
Best Practices for Data Pump
Case Studies
Advanced Data Pump Techniques
Lesson 7: Oracle GoldenGate
Introduction to Oracle GoldenGate
GoldenGate Architecture
GoldenGate Components
Installation and Configuration
Configuring GoldenGate Processes
Data Replication and Synchronization
Monitoring and Managing GoldenGate
Troubleshooting GoldenGate Issues
Best Practices for GoldenGate
Case Studies
Lesson 8: Oracle SQL Developer
Introduction to Oracle SQL Developer
SQL Developer Features and Capabilities
Installation and Configuration
Database Connections and Navigation
SQL and PL/SQL Development
Data Modeling and Design
Database Administration
Migration Utilities in SQL Developer
Best Practices for SQL Developer
Case Studies
Module 3: Advanced Migration Techniques
Lesson 9: Advanced Data Migration Techniques
Overview of Advanced Data Migration
Data Transformation and Cleansing
Data Mapping and Conversion
Handling Large Data Volumes
Parallel Processing and Performance Tuning
Data Validation and Verification
Error Handling and Recovery
Automating Migration Processes
Best Practices for Advanced Data Migration
Case Studies
Lesson 10: Handling Complex Data Types
Overview of Complex Data Types
LOB (Large Object) Data Types
XML Data Types
JSON Data Types
Spatial Data Types
Handling Complex Data in Migration
Data Transformation Techniques
Performance Considerations
Best Practices for Complex Data Migration
Case Studies
Lesson 11: Migration of Database Objects
Overview of Database Objects
Tables and Indexes
Views and Materialized Views
Stored Procedures and Functions
Triggers and Packages
Sequences and Synonyms
Handling Dependencies and References
Data Integrity and Constraints
Best Practices for Object Migration
Case Studies
Lesson 12: Handling Database Security and Permissions
Overview of Database Security
User Accounts and Roles
Privileges and Permissions
Authentication and Authorization
Encryption and Data Masking
Auditing and Compliance
Handling Security in Migration
Best Practices for Security Migration
Case Studies
Troubleshooting Security Issues
Module 4: Performance Tuning and Optimization
Lesson 13: Performance Tuning for Migration
Overview of Performance Tuning
Identifying Performance Bottlenecks
Query Optimization Techniques
Indexing Strategies
Partitioning and Parallel Processing
Memory and Resource Management
Monitoring and Diagnostics
Best Practices for Performance Tuning
Case Studies
Troubleshooting Performance Issues
Lesson 14: Monitoring and Managing Migration Processes
Overview of Migration Monitoring
Monitoring Tools and Technologies
Setting Up Monitoring and Alerts
Performance Metrics and KPIs
Log Analysis and Reporting
Handling Migration Failures
Recovery and Rollback Strategies
Best Practices for Migration Monitoring
Case Studies
Troubleshooting Monitoring Issues
Lesson 15: Handling Large-Scale Migrations
Overview of Large-Scale Migrations
Planning and Preparation
Resource Allocation and Management
Parallel Processing and Load Balancing
Data Partitioning and Chunking
Performance Considerations
Monitoring and Managing Large-Scale Migrations
Best Practices for Large-Scale Migrations
Case Studies
Troubleshooting Large-Scale Migration Issues
Lesson 16: Handling Cross-Platform Migrations
Overview of Cross-Platform Migrations
Challenges and Considerations
Compatibility and Interoperability
Data Type and Character Set Conversion
Handling Platform-Specific Features
Performance and Optimization
Best Practices for Cross-Platform Migrations
Case Studies
Troubleshooting Cross-Platform Migration Issues
Tools and Technologies for Cross-Platform Migrations
Module 5: Post-Migration Activities
Lesson 17: Post-Migration Validation and Testing
Overview of Post-Migration Validation
Data Integrity and Consistency Checks
Functional Testing
Performance Testing
User Acceptance Testing
Handling Validation Failures
Best Practices for Post-Migration Validation
Case Studies
Troubleshooting Validation Issues
Documentation and Reporting
Lesson 18: Post-Migration Optimization
Overview of Post-Migration Optimization
Identifying Optimization Opportunities
Query and Index Optimization
Resource and Memory Management
Performance Tuning Techniques
Monitoring and Diagnostics
Best Practices for Post-Migration Optimization
Case Studies
Troubleshooting Optimization Issues
Documentation and Reporting
Lesson 19: Handling Post-Migration Issues
Overview of Post-Migration Issues
Common Post-Migration Problems
Identifying and Diagnosing Issues
Handling Data Corruption and Loss
Performance and Stability Issues
Security and Compliance Issues
Best Practices for Handling Post-Migration Issues
Case Studies
Troubleshooting Post-Migration Issues
Documentation and Reporting
Lesson 20: Post-Migration Documentation and Reporting
Overview of Post-Migration Documentation
Documenting Migration Processes and Procedures
Reporting Migration Results and Outcomes
Documenting Lessons Learned and Best Practices
Creating User and Administrator Guides
Handling Documentation Updates and Revisions
Best Practices for Post-Migration Documentation
Case Studies
Troubleshooting Documentation Issues
Tools and Technologies for Documentation
Module 6: Advanced Topics in Oracle Database Migration
Lesson 21: Handling Distributed Database Migrations
Overview of Distributed Database Migrations
Challenges and Considerations
Planning and Preparation
Handling Data Distribution and Replication
Performance and Optimization
Monitoring and Managing Distributed Migrations
Best Practices for Distributed Database Migrations
Case Studies
Troubleshooting Distributed Migration Issues
Tools and Technologies for Distributed Migrations
Lesson 22: Handling Cloud-Based Migrations
Overview of Cloud-Based Migrations
Challenges and Considerations
Planning and Preparation
Handling Data Transfer and Synchronization
Performance and Optimization
Monitoring and Managing Cloud-Based Migrations
Best Practices for Cloud-Based Migrations
Case Studies
Troubleshooting Cloud-Based Migration Issues
Tools and Technologies for Cloud-Based Migrations
Lesson 23: Handling Real-Time Data Migrations
Overview of Real-Time Data Migrations
Challenges and Considerations
Planning and Preparation
Handling Data Synchronization and Replication
Performance and Optimization
Monitoring and Managing Real-Time Migrations
Best Practices for Real-Time Data Migrations
Case Studies
Troubleshooting Real-Time Migration Issues
Tools and Technologies for Real-Time Migrations
Lesson 24: Handling High Availability and Disaster Recovery Migrations
Overview of High Availability and Disaster Recovery Migrations
Challenges and Considerations
Planning and Preparation
Handling Data Replication and Failover
Performance and Optimization
Monitoring and Managing High Availability Migrations
Best Practices for High Availability and Disaster Recovery Migrations
Case Studies
Troubleshooting High Availability Migration Issues
Tools and Technologies for High Availability Migrations
Module 7: Case Studies and Best Practices
Lesson 25: Case Study 1 – Large-Scale Enterprise Migration
Overview of the Case Study
Migration Objectives and Scope
Planning and Preparation
Migration Strategies and Approaches
Tools and Technologies Used
Challenges and Solutions
Performance and Optimization
Post-Migration Validation and Testing
Lessons Learned and Best Practices
Documentation and Reporting
Lesson 26: Case Study 2 – Cross-Platform Migration
Overview of the Case Study
Migration Objectives and Scope
Planning and Preparation
Migration Strategies and Approaches
Tools and Technologies Used
Challenges and Solutions
Performance and Optimization
Post-Migration Validation and Testing
Lessons Learned and Best Practices
Documentation and Reporting
Lesson 27: Case Study 3 – Cloud-Based Migration
Overview of the Case Study
Migration Objectives and Scope
Planning and Preparation
Migration Strategies and Approaches
Tools and Technologies Used
Challenges and Solutions
Performance and Optimization
Post-Migration Validation and Testing
Lessons Learned and Best Practices
Documentation and Reporting
Lesson 28: Case Study 4 – Real-Time Data Migration
Overview of the Case Study
Migration Objectives and Scope
Planning and Preparation
Migration Strategies and Approaches
Tools and Technologies Used
Challenges and Solutions
Performance and Optimization
Post-Migration Validation and Testing
Lessons Learned and Best Practices
Documentation and Reporting
Module 8: Troubleshooting and Support
Lesson 29: Troubleshooting Common Migration Issues
Overview of Common Migration Issues
Identifying and Diagnosing Issues
Handling Data Corruption and Loss
Performance and Stability Issues
Security and Compliance Issues
Best Practices for Troubleshooting
Case Studies
Tools and Technologies for Troubleshooting
Documentation and Reporting
Handling Escalations and Support
Lesson 30: Handling Migration Failures and Rollbacks
Overview of Migration Failures and Rollbacks
Identifying and Diagnosing Failures
Handling Data Corruption and Loss
Performance and Stability Issues
Security and Compliance Issues
Best Practices for Handling Failures and Rollbacks
Case Studies
Tools and Technologies for Handling Failures and Rollbacks
Documentation and Reporting
Handling Escalations and Support
Lesson 31: Handling Performance and Stability Issues
Overview of Performance and Stability Issues
Identifying and Diagnosing Issues
Handling Data Corruption and Loss
Performance and Stability Issues
Security and Compliance Issues
Best Practices for Handling Performance and Stability Issues
Case Studies
Tools and Technologies for Handling Performance and Stability Issues
Documentation and Reporting
Handling Escalations and Support
Lesson 32: Handling Security and Compliance Issues
Overview of Security and Compliance Issues
Identifying and Diagnosing Issues
Handling Data Corruption and Loss
Performance and Stability Issues
Security and Compliance Issues
Best Practices for Handling Security and Compliance Issues
Case Studies
Tools and Technologies for Handling Security and Compliance Issues
Documentation and Reporting
Handling Escalations and Support
Module 9: Advanced Tools and Technologies
Lesson 33: Advanced Oracle Migration Tools
Overview of Advanced Oracle Migration Tools
Oracle Data Pump Advanced Features
Oracle GoldenGate Advanced Features
Oracle SQL Developer Advanced Features
Oracle Migration Workbench Advanced Features
Oracle Database Upgrade Assistant Advanced Features
Third-Party Migration Tools Advanced Features
Best Practices for Advanced Tools
Case Studies
Troubleshooting Advanced Tools Issues
Lesson 34: Advanced Data Transformation Techniques
Overview of Advanced Data Transformation
Data Cleansing and Enrichment
Data Mapping and Conversion
Handling Complex Data Types
Performance and Optimization
Monitoring and Managing Data Transformation
Best Practices for Advanced Data Transformation
Case Studies
Troubleshooting Data Transformation Issues
Tools and Technologies for Advanced Data Transformation
Lesson 35: Advanced Performance Tuning Techniques
Overview of Advanced Performance Tuning
Identifying Performance Bottlenecks
Query Optimization Techniques
Indexing Strategies
Partitioning and Parallel Processing
Memory and Resource Management
Monitoring and Diagnostics
Best Practices for Advanced Performance Tuning
Case Studies
Troubleshooting Performance Tuning Issues
Lesson 36: Advanced Monitoring and Management Techniques
Overview of Advanced Monitoring and Management
Monitoring Tools and Technologies
Setting Up Monitoring and Alerts
Performance Metrics and KPIs
Log Analysis and Reporting
Handling Migration Failures
Recovery and Rollback Strategies
Best Practices for Advanced Monitoring and Management
Case Studies
Troubleshooting Monitoring and Management Issues
Module 10: Future Trends and Emerging Technologies
Lesson 37: Future Trends in Database Migration
Overview of Future Trends
Emerging Technologies and Tools
Cloud-Based Migrations
Real-Time Data Migrations
High Availability and Disaster Recovery Migrations
Distributed Database Migrations
Best Practices for Future Trends
Case Studies
Troubleshooting Future Trends Issues
Documentation and Reporting
Lesson 38: Emerging Technologies in Database Migration
Overview of Emerging Technologies
Artificial Intelligence and Machine Learning
Blockchain and Distributed Ledger Technology
Internet of Things (IoT)
Big Data and Analytics
Best Practices for Emerging Technologies
Case Studies
Troubleshooting Emerging Technologies Issues
Documentation and Reporting
Tools and Technologies for Emerging Technologies
Lesson 39: Best Practices for Future-Proofing Migrations
Overview of Future-Proofing Migrations
Planning and Preparation
Handling Data Growth and Scalability
Performance and Optimization
Security and Compliance
Monitoring and Managing Future-Proof Migrations
Best Practices for Future-Proofing Migrations
Case Studies
Troubleshooting Future-Proofing Issues
Documentation and Reporting
Lesson 40: Conclusion and Final Thoughts
Overview of the Course
Key Takeaways and Lessons Learned
Best Practices and Recommendations
Future Trends and Emerging Technologies
Handling Challenges and Solutions
Documentation and Reporting
Handling Escalations and Support
Case Studies
Troubleshooting Final Thoughts Issues
Final Thoughts and Conclusion



Reviews
There are no reviews yet.